Libre Baskerville vs Cinzel

Both are serif faces on Google Fonts. Libre Baskerville has the larger x-height, so it looks bigger at the same size. Cinzel takes more horizontal space.

Measured differences

Measured from the font files. Heights and widths are shown as a share of the font size, so they compare directly at any point size.
MeasurementLibre BaskervilleCinzelDifference
x-heightHeight of lowercase letters, as a share of the font size. Higher reads larger at the same point size.53.0%50.0%3.0%
Cap heightHeight of capitals, as a share of the font size.77.0%70.0%7.0%
x-height to cap ratioProportion of lowercase to uppercase. Higher feels more modern and open.0.690.710.03
Stroke weightMeasured thickness of a vertical stroke. Higher is heavier on the page.11.3%7.4%3.9%
Stroke contrastHorizontal stroke divided by vertical. 1.0 is even; below 0.5 means strong thick-thin modulation.0.440.410.03
Average character widthMean lowercase advance. Higher takes more horizontal space.58.7%63.9%5.2%
